You're always better on your feet against multiple opponents which is why grappling is a huge advantage in the situation.
Takedown defense and scrambling back to your feet are 10x more important skills in the situation than any sort of offense. Those skills let you get away and survive. The distance control skills you get from striking is a big deal too.
But none of the offense you learn in either is really all that effective and more likely to get you in trouble.
Personally I think a weapon is your only chance so ironically TMAs that teach weapon use are probably your best MA for multiple opponents. You know assuming you have a sword or spear on you or something
Careful choosing your weapon martial art though! If youβre not moving around and not sparring in some form, youβre gonna have trouble applying the techniques in a live fight.
